Appchains: Dapps Surpassing Blockchains in Revenue Generation

Appchains are emerging as a revolutionary concept in the blockchain landscape, reflecting a significant shift in how decentralized applications (dapps) interact with blockchain technology. For the first time, dapps are outpacing traditional blockchains in revenue generation, indicating a newfound value that prioritizes user engagement and transactions. Recent reports reveal that in the first quarter of 2024, while blockchains earned a total of $1.4 billion, dapps achieved an impressive $1.8 billion, highlighting this remarkable trend. This surge has implications for the crypto trends, particularly as platforms like Uniswap create their own appchains to capture previously lost revenues. As more decentralized applications explore this innovative direction, the potential for increased dapps revenue will likely redefine the future of blockchain and its applications in the digital economy.

The Emergence of Appchains in the DeFi Ecosystem

As decentralized applications (dapps) continue to dominate the blockchain landscape, the concept of appchains has emerged as a promising solution to capture additional revenue and enhance user experience. Appchains, or application-specific blockchains, are designed to meet the unique needs of dapps, allowing for greater flexibility and efficiency in operations. By decentralizing their infrastructure, dapp developers can create environments that are tailor-made for their specific services, streamlining processes and reducing overhead costs associated with operating on a traditional blockchain.

This shift towards appchains reflects a broader trend where developers must prioritize user experience and operational efficiency. Platforms like Uniswap have already set the precedent by launching their own chains, allowing them to reclaim transaction fees previously lost to more generalized blockchains. The rise of appchains signifies a strategic response to the growing costs and limitations experienced on conventional blockchain systems, enabling dapps to thrive independently while maximizing their revenue potential.

The Revenue Model of Dapps vs. Traditional Blockchains

The recent data revealing that dapps have generated more revenue than traditional blockchains underscores a seismic shift in the cryptocurrency market. With dapps bringing in $1.8 billion compared to the $1.4 billion netted by blockchains, there’s a growing recognition that the real value in the blockchain space comes from the applications built on these technologies. This pivot necessitates a reevaluation of existing blockchain models which have long been viewed as the cornerstone of cryptocurrency value creation. The stark contrast in revenue reveals that users are more inclined to engage with decentralized applications that offer tangible services rather than the underlying technology itself.

As dapps grow in prominence, it becomes essential to explore diverse revenue models that capitalize on user engagement. While traditional blockchains often depend on transaction fees and mining for revenue, dapps can employ various monetization strategies, including fee structures, in-app purchases, and subscription models. This shift towards user-centric business models positions dapps favorably, allowing them to attract and retain users, ultimately driving revenue growth in ways that traditional blockchains can still only aspire to achieve.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are appchains and how do they relate to dapps revenue?

Appchains are specialized blockchains tailored for decentralized applications (dapps) that optimize their performance and revenue generation. As dapps have begun to outpace traditional blockchains in revenue, appchains provide a platform for these applications to manage transactions, fees, and user experience more efficiently.

How has dapp revenue surpassed blockchain revenue in 2024?

In the first quarter of 2024, dapps generated $1.8 billion in revenue, exceeding the $1.4 billion earned by blockchains. This trend signals a growing recognition that the value of blockchain technology is increasingly derived from the applications built on top of it, rather than the infrastructure itself.

What impact does Uniswap’s appchain have on decentralized applications?

Uniswap’s launch of its own appchain allows it to reclaim over $70 million in fees previously paid to Ethereum, enhancing its revenue model. This move demonstrates how dapps can improve economic efficiency and user experience by creating tailored solutions through appchains.

Key Point Details
Revenue Comparison For Q1 2024, dapps generated $1.8 billion, while blockchains brought in $1.4 billion.
Shift in Value Perception Dapps are starting to be seen as more valuable than blockchains, reflecting a trend towards applications driving revenue.
Emergence of Appchains Dapps may begin launching their own chains to enhance revenue by capturing transaction fee revenue directly.
Example Case – Uniswap Uniswap has launched its own chain, Unichain, aiming to save on fees and create new revenue opportunities.
Custom Chains for Dapps Developers can create chains focused on their specific needs, offering better performance and user experience.
